Way they start with some flashbacks to RHOC gone by, that now includes Vicki and Tamra but they go back even further. And they will all be wrapped in virginal white dresses this season it seems. Who is doing the talking? The new girl?

Shannon has a new man, John who seems nice enough I guess. And she has a new house. John has three older kids and they are one big happy family that does not live together. On of Shannon’s kids as a lot of ear piercings. I feel like that is a cry for help. IJS. But Shannon, John and all six kids seem very happy.

Rick and Kelly and Kelly’s daughter are also getting along. And Kelly just married Rick last weekend. Kelly’s daughter is 13 and suddenly a handful. Kelly deserves this. They take Rick to get his tarot read.

Gina has a new house and is apparently not in a casita anymore. Shannon brought her a housewarming gift…nine lemons in a bowl.  It’s actually a normal person’s house. These two bond over their hatred for Braunwyn. I can’t even remember who I hated yesterday let alone who hates who on this show. Kelly and Braunwyn are both moving into “Shannon’s neighborhood.”

Meet The New Girl

Kelly and Braunwyn are off to pick up the new girl, Elizabeth. I haven’t paid any attention to her at all. During this pandemic, I’m doing the best I can to post at all. Kelly is the designated housewife to introduce Elizabeth. Apparently, they used to be next door neighbors. She’s rich. When this was filmed, her beautiful beach house seemed to be a LONG way to the beach. I mean she is on the beach and there is nothing built between her house and the ocean, but that’s a very low tide or there is some sort of inability to build due to sinking sand or something. It’s a beautiful view with cactus and stuff. There is a bike path super close to her deck and the ladies flirt with the teenagers.

Kelly and Shannon are trying to make up. Kelly gave Shannon a deck of Uno cards because her other two tres amigas are gone. These two have no place to go so they make up.

Winding Things Down

Gina likes new boyfriend,  Travis. Gina and Matt have decided to divorce amicably and get along and co-parent. Things are calming down on the lawsuit/restraining order front and they all just want to get along for the sake of the kids. We shall see how long that lasts.

Braunwyn and Emily make amends. Emily has had a hip replacement. It was barely mentioned. Braunwyn lets us know that her real problem at the moment is that she is getting a divorce. I would reckon this sort of thing happens when your husband has a “love nest” near his office. Or maybe I am out to far in the story line and Braunwyn start saying she has a drinking problem and doesn’t plan to drink because she is an alcoholic. I hope Braunwyn feels better soon.
